The Vanguard Youth Arts Collective is a group of creatively driven youth who act as a voice for an emerging generation of the arts within the Windsor Essex region. They nurture creative development by fostering connections within the community and enrich the artistic culture in our community through youth engagement. Paint, Paint, Pass : A Collaborative Painting Workshop with Chantal Brouillard (she/her)
This workshop will allow participants to create their own painting, and contribute their own creativity to the work of other participants. All participants will exchange their paintings with one another every 20-30 minutes for a collaborative and intuitive experience.
